Danish startup Dixa with offices in Ukraine raises $105M

On July 28, 2021, Denmark-based Dixa announced a new $105 million Series C round, as the startup told AIN.UA. The valuation of the project in this round is not disclosed, but the company says that it is on the way to unicorn status.

  • The company plans to spend the new funding on product development, scaling to new markets, and acquiring new companies (for example, Dixa merged with Melbourne-based Elevio in January 2021). The management also intends to quadruple the engineering team by the end of 2022.
  • As for the Ukrainian offices, currently, nine people are working in Kyiv and Lviv, mainly marketing and sales specialists. However, Dixa plans to hire new technical specialists in Europe, including Ukraine.
  • Dixa was founded in 2015, released the product in 2018, and raised a $14 million Series A round in 2019. Since its public release, it has grown from 12 to 200 employees. Dixa has offices in Copenhagen, London, New York, Tel Aviv, Melbourne, Berlin, Kyiv, and Lviv.
  • Dixa develops a platform for user support. Its services allow to combine requests from different channels – phone, email, Facebook Messenger, WhatsApp, and SMS – and connect them with responsible employees.

Dixa raised its last Series B round in February 2020, worth $36 million, and the total amount raised so far is about $155 million.
